Wyzant
Apply To Tutor
Get Started for Free ›
tutortutor
tutortutor
tutortutor
tutortutor
tutortutor
tutortutor
Trust the nation's largest network for coding tutors

More than 4 million 5-star reviews

65,000 expert tutors in 300+ subjects

Find a great match with our Good Fit Guarantee

More than 4 million 5-star reviews

65,000 expert tutors in 300+ subjects

Find a great match with our Good Fit Guarantee

Featured by the nation’s most respected news sources

New York TimesCNNChicago TribuneCNBCForbesCBS NewsFox News

Tutors from top universities

JulliardMITRISDColumbiaCarnegie MellonBerkeleyHarvard

Get 1:1 Help Fast

The Best coding Tutors in Marin County, CA

See all 1,241 matching tutors

Find the best local coding tutor in Marin County

Simon Z. San Francisco, CA, available for online & in-person tutoring
Simon Z.
119/hour

San Francisco, CA

Coding Interviews, Computer Science, SATs, College Admissions

I've worked with students of all ages from a 10 year old preparing for the SHSAT to 40 year olds who are preparing for coding interviews. As a Coding Interview coach, I have gone through more than 200 programming interviews...

5.0 (40)
119/hour
42 hours tutoring

I've worked with students of all ages from a 10 year old preparing for the SHSAT to 40 year olds who are preparing for coding interviews. As a Coding Interview coach, I have gone through more than 200 programming interviews...

Ulrich K. Petaluma, CA, available for online & in-person tutoring
Ulrich K.
73/hour

Petaluma, CA

Experienced German language instructor and native speaker

My students have come to appreciate my blended conversational approach and the fact that I have my own website which they can use to practice the language in between sessions. I author and code everything myself and develop my own classroom...

5.0 (358)
73/hour
1,098 hours tutoring

My students have come to appreciate my blended conversational approach and the fact that I have my own website which they can use to practice the language in between sessions. I author and code everything myself and develop my own classroom...

Michael T. Emeryville, CA, available for online & in-person tutoring
Michael T.
50/hour

Emeryville, CA

Experienced Software Engineer/Tutor

I have a Bachelor degree in Computer Science from Cal Poly San Luis Obispo. As a tutor, my goal is to share my passion of coding and using my knowledge to make an impact in their lives. Coding might not be easiest thing for a lot...

4.9 (63)
50/hour
125 hours tutoring

I have a Bachelor degree in Computer Science from Cal Poly San Luis Obispo. As a tutor, my goal is to share my passion of coding and using my knowledge to make an impact in their lives. Coding might not be easiest thing for a lot...

Lorenzo B. San Francisco, CA, available for online & in-person tutoring
Lorenzo B.
99/hour

San Francisco, CA

PhD in Computer Science | Expert Tutor & Consultant w/ Real-World Exp

Alongside university work I founded a San Francisco consulting studio that trains developers through pro-bono projects for nonprofits, so my tutoring is rooted in the real intersection of code, data, and impact. Much of my teaching...

5.0 (5)
99/hour
34 hours tutoring

Alongside university work I founded a San Francisco consulting studio that trains developers through pro-bono projects for nonprofits, so my tutoring is rooted in the real intersection of code, data, and impact. Much of my teaching...

Aaron K. San Francisco, CA, available for online & in-person tutoring
Aaron K.
225/hour

San Francisco, CA

Artificial Intelligence Researcher and Data Science Instructor

...from complex quantitative problems. During my time at Google, my software expertise helped me contribute C++ and Python code to large production codebases utilized in YouTube's machine learning-based video encoding infrastructure. ...

5.0 (21)
225/hour
38 hours tutoring

...from complex quantitative problems. During my time at Google, my software expertise helped me contribute C++ and Python code to large production codebases utilized in YouTube's machine learning-based video encoding infrastructure. ...

Lawrence L. San Francisco, CA, available for online & in-person tutoring
Lawrence L.
100/hour

San Francisco, CA

Insightful Computer Science & Coding Tutor for 7+ years (B.A.)

I'm Lawrence, a graduate from Boston University with a degree in Psychology & Computer Science. I have 7+ years of tutoring experience spread across Computer Science & Coding subjects for students of all levels. My experience...

5.0 (367)
100/hour
1,515 hours tutoring

I'm Lawrence, a graduate from Boston University with a degree in Psychology & Computer Science. I have 7+ years of tutoring experience spread across Computer Science & Coding subjects for students of all levels. My experience...

Thurston N. San Francisco, CA, available for online & in-person tutoring
Thurston N.
73/hour

San Francisco, CA

Professional Java Software Engiineer with 15+ years experience

I've been programming in Java for over 15 years, mostly for Bay Area companies and consulting with global companies, as well as running coding bootcamps for students that use Java as the main language.

4.8 (99)
73/hour
650 hours tutoring

I've been programming in Java for over 15 years, mostly for Bay Area companies and consulting with global companies, as well as running coding bootcamps for students that use Java as the main language.

Oliver M. Oakland, CA, available for online & in-person tutoring
Oliver M.
149/hour

Oakland, CA

Startup and PhD UC Berkeley 13+ Years Python Data Science

Come explore one of the most exciting programming languages! With over 13 years of experience, I have been coding with Python at several tech Startups and in my PhD at UC Berkeley. I have developed math / stat models, Machine Learning,...

5.0 (259)
149/hour
1,218 hours tutoring

Come explore one of the most exciting programming languages! With over 13 years of experience, I have been coding with Python at several tech Startups and in my PhD at UC Berkeley. I have developed math / stat models, Machine Learning,...

Brian L. Alameda, CA, available for online & in-person tutoring
Brian L.
299/hour

Alameda, CA

Former Math Professor. Data Science / Machine Learning Expert

I am a regular speaker / presenter at ODSC (Open Data Science Conference). When not teaching and consulting, I am active in research (publishing in academic journals / conferences), open source code development (I'm the...

5.0 (52)
299/hour
150 hours tutoring

I am a regular speaker / presenter at ODSC (Open Data Science Conference). When not teaching and consulting, I am active in research (publishing in academic journals / conferences), open source code development (I'm the...

Ryan F. Novato, CA, available for online & in-person tutoring
Ryan F.
240/hour

Novato, CA

Retired University Professor of (Astro)Physics

I graduated magna cum laude with a Bachelor’s in Physics and Mathematics (double major) from Wheaton College (Norton, MA). For my honors thesis I developed a magnetohydrodynamics code in Python. Subsequently, I earned my PhD in Astronomy...

5.0 (71)
240/hour
346 hours tutoring

I graduated magna cum laude with a Bachelor’s in Physics and Mathematics (double major) from Wheaton College (Norton, MA). For my honors thesis I developed a magnetohydrodynamics code in Python. Subsequently, I earned my PhD in Astronomy...

Tyler G. San Francisco, CA, available for online & in-person tutoring
Tyler G.
60/hour

San Francisco, CA

Certified Public Accountant with expertise in Tax

...a score of 92. I have experience working at a Big Four Public Accounting Firm and extensive knowledge on the current Tax Code and Regulations. I'm looking forward to helping others achieve similar success!...

5.0 (9)
60/hour
20 hours tutoring

...a score of 92. I have experience working at a Big Four Public Accounting Firm and extensive knowledge on the current Tax Code and Regulations. I'm looking forward to helping others achieve similar success!...

Dexter R. San Francisco, CA, available for online & in-person tutoring
Dexter R.
65/hour

San Francisco, CA

Coding Tutor: Roblox | Scratch | Python | Apps Script | C++ | Arduino

Does your kid love Roblox and want to learn how to program? I can teach them! I have worked in the computer industry for over 20 years, including at Google, YouTube, Adobe, and several Silicon Valley startups. I am a passionate and...

5.0 (34)
65/hour
95 hours tutoring

Does your kid love Roblox and want to learn how to program? I can teach them! I have worked in the computer industry for over 20 years, including at Google, YouTube, Adobe, and several Silicon Valley startups. I am a passionate and...

Surya Teja E. San Francisco, CA, available for online & in-person tutoring
Surya Teja E.
30/hour

San Francisco, CA

Patient Programming Tutor | Python, AI, Data Science, Web Apps

For those interested in cutting-edge skills, I teach AI-assisted development using modern tools like Cursor, Windsurf, VSCode with Gemini, ChatGPT, Anthropic Claude Code, Lovable, and V0. I guide students not just in writing code...

5.0 (45)
30/hour
113 hours tutoring
Response time: 24 minutes

For those interested in cutting-edge skills, I teach AI-assisted development using modern tools like Cursor, Windsurf, VSCode with Gemini, ChatGPT, Anthropic Claude Code, Lovable, and V0. I guide students not just in writing code...

Brian S. Berkeley, CA, available for online & in-person tutoring
Brian S.
150/hour

Berkeley, CA

Software Engineer at Amazon

I have been coding for years, and received the equivalent of more than a minor in computer science at Yale. I've taken courses in data structures, programming techniques, algorithms (proof-based), quantum computing, and more.

5.0 (66)
150/hour
98 hours tutoring

I have been coding for years, and received the equivalent of more than a minor in computer science at Yale. I've taken courses in data structures, programming techniques, algorithms (proof-based), quantum computing, and more.

William B. Santa Rosa, CA, available for online & in-person tutoring
William B.
150/hour

Santa Rosa, CA

Textbook Author, Former Scientist and Teacher, who Loves Teaching!

... exam, "Kweller Prep Advanced Placement Physics 1". Now I run a home school program teaching assorted math, science, coding, biology, and robotics courses, and my students leave my school over prepared for the schools they transfer to. I simply...

4.9 (465)
150/hour
1,977 hours tutoring

... exam, "Kweller Prep Advanced Placement Physics 1". Now I run a home school program teaching assorted math, science, coding, biology, and robotics courses, and my students leave my school over prepared for the schools they transfer to. I simply...

Samantha R. San Francisco, CA, available for online & in-person tutoring
Samantha R.
60/hour

San Francisco, CA

Senior Software Engineer with 6+ Years of Experience

...computer programming and web development for coding bootcamps, including at UC Berkeley Extension. This includes multiple years of experience working on Ruby on Rails web applications and other Ruby coding experience....

InstantBook
Today
5.0 (129)
60/hour
187 hours tutoring

...computer programming and web development for coding bootcamps, including at UC Berkeley Extension. This includes multiple years of experience working on Ruby on Rails web applications and other Ruby coding experience....

Here are even more great coding tutors who offer online lessons.

Here are even more great coding tutors who offer online lessons.

Charlottesville, VA Tutoring
Justin Y.
80/hour

CS Student with 6+ Years of Experience

I have coded in C++ for 6+ years. All Computer Vision projects were coded in C++. I mainly utilize C++ for competitive programming.

5.0 (47)
80/hour
165 hours tutoring

I have coded in C++ for 6+ years. All Computer Vision projects were coded in C++. I mainly utilize C++ for competitive programming.

Belgrade, MT Tutoring
Michelle V.
75/hour

Data Scientist with 6+ Years Experience in Python

...introduction to the Python language, data structures, and data manipulation using the language. I'm familiar with both applied coding and work with algorithms and data structures....

InstantBook
This week
5.0 (152)
75/hour
513 hours tutoring
Response time: 22 minutes

...introduction to the Python language, data structures, and data manipulation using the language. I'm familiar with both applied coding and work with algorithms and data structures....

Temecula, CA Tutoring
John R.
60/hour

California-Based Software Developer | Practical Coding Tutor

I’m Johhannas (or John), a California-based software developer with a Bachelor’s degree in Computer Science from the University of California, Irvine. I’ve been writing code for over 10 years and began tutoring during my second...

4.5 (17)
60/hour
90 hours tutoring

I’m Johhannas (or John), a California-based software developer with a Bachelor’s degree in Computer Science from the University of California, Irvine. I’ve been writing code for over 10 years and began tutoring during my second...

Colorado Springs, CO Tutoring
Shawn P.
70/hour

Professional Tutor for Python and other Programming Languages

...skills. The primary subject I teach is Python programming. If you need help understanding specific topics, debugging your code, or figuring out how to plan and implement difficult projects, I am well equipped to aid you. If you need help with homework...

5.0 (505)
70/hour
2,007 hours tutoring
Response time: 36 minutes

...skills. The primary subject I teach is Python programming. If you need help understanding specific topics, debugging your code, or figuring out how to plan and implement difficult projects, I am well equipped to aid you. If you need help with homework...

Philadelphia, PA Tutoring
Brett S.
100/hour

Senior Software Engineer

My day job is writing C# code, although in the past I have worked with Javascript/Typescript, Python, Java, Haskell, Scheme, and MIPS assembly. I graduated summa cum laude with a degree in Computer Science. I specialize in writing...

5.0 (156)
100/hour
645 hours tutoring
Response time: 43 minutes

My day job is writing C# code, although in the past I have worked with Javascript/Typescript, Python, Java, Haskell, Scheme, and MIPS assembly. I graduated summa cum laude with a degree in Computer Science. I specialize in writing...

Danville, CA Tutoring
Shreyas T.
100/hour

UCLA Computer Science Student, Perfect ACT Scorer

Please feel free to reach out if you are interested; I am quite flexible with scheduling. Subjects I Tutor: Test Prep(AP Computer Science, SAT/ACT), Coding(includes USACO prep), Math(Calculus primarily) Relevant Advanced...

5.0 (60)
100/hour
190 hours tutoring

Please feel free to reach out if you are interested; I am quite flexible with scheduling. Subjects I Tutor: Test Prep(AP Computer Science, SAT/ACT), Coding(includes USACO prep), Math(Calculus primarily) Relevant Advanced...

Walnut Creek, CA Tutoring
Umair A.
35/hour

Expert Web Designer with 4+ Years of Experience in Web Applications

I specialize in transforming ideas into fully functional, user-friendly websites that align with clients' goals. Whether you're seeking guidance on design principles or hands-on coding assistance, I provide tailored support to...

5.0 (693)
35/hour
1,417 hours tutoring
Response time: 41 minutes

I specialize in transforming ideas into fully functional, user-friendly websites that align with clients' goals. Whether you're seeking guidance on design principles or hands-on coding assistance, I provide tailored support to...

Mcminnville, OR Tutoring
Seth M.
64/hour

Patient Tutor with Real-World JavaScript and TypeScript Experience

I've written hundreds of JavaScript programs, both for front-end websites and back-end node-server systems. And if you are trying to make the shift to more robust coding, I can help you learn TypeScript, too.

InstantBook
Today
5.0 (1899)
64/hour
6,752 hours tutoring
Response time: 0 minutes

I've written hundreds of JavaScript programs, both for front-end websites and back-end node-server systems. And if you are trying to make the shift to more robust coding, I can help you learn TypeScript, too.

Mckinney, TX Tutoring
Ted L.
135/hour

Bachelor of Arts in Computer Science and Freelance Software Developer

...security, and Internet/network programming. However, I much prefer to utilize these principles when writing/debugging actual code, rather than just studying them for the sake of pure academic understanding (i.e. I don't like doing tutoring sessions for...

5.0 (1116)
135/hour
4,199 hours tutoring

...security, and Internet/network programming. However, I much prefer to utilize these principles when writing/debugging actual code, rather than just studying them for the sake of pure academic understanding (i.e. I don't like doing tutoring sessions for...

Trusted with over 6 million hours of lessons since 2005

Trusted experience

Success stories

Real stories from real people

Since 2005, Wyzant has provided a way for people to learn any subject in a way that works for them.

Valerie M.

4 coding lessons

Joel did an excellent job in helping me to understand basic concepts in coding. He routinely provides alternative solutions to broaden my scope of what is possible in python coding. He is a wealth of knowledge and can explain coding concepts with extreme precision. He is very patient in his teaching style and very thorough. I would highly recommend Joel for anyone wanting to learn coding at any level.
Brenna J.

17 coding lessons

Audrey is the very best medical coding tutor I could ever hope to find. She is a true expert in the field and I have learned so much valuable information from her. Most importantly with her help I just passed my CPC exam with over 90% on my first attempt. Not only did I pass this critical exam, but I am so much better prepared for the competitive coding workforce with everything she has taught me.
Mohammed A.

2 coding lessons

He is a wealth of knowledge and can explain coding concepts with extreme precision. He is very patient in his teaching style and very thorough. I highly recommend jimmy to anyone wanting to learn coding at any level. He is prompt, courteous, and genuinely cares about his student's success in understanding and mastering key concepts. He was able to review my coding samples and provide excellent feedback on each section of my project by articulating complex concepts with ease.
How much for private coding tutoring lessons

Tutors on Wyzant Cost $35 - 60 per hour on average

Tutors using Wyzant are professional subject experts who set their own price based on their demand and skill.

$25$88
$35
$60
Choose Your Tutor

Compare tutor costs. With a range of price options, there’s a tutor for every budget.

No Upfront Fees

Sign up, search, and message with expert tutors free of charge.

No Costly Packages

Only pay for the time you need. Whether it’s one lesson or seven, you decide what to spend.

Love Your Lesson Or It’s Free

Your first hour with a new tutor is protected by Wyzant’s Good Fit Guarantee. If you’re not satisfied with your lesson, you don’t pay. No questions asked.

Reported on by leading news outlets

tech crunch
the new york times
CNBC

Find Tutors in Subjects Related to Coding

If you are looking to learn a subject similar to coding, tap into the nation’s largest community of online tutors. Find your ideal tutor by reading ratings and reviews:

Video Production Tutors | Json Tutors | Cuda Tutors | C++ Tutors | C# Tutors | Perl Tutors | Personal Statements Tutors | Executive Functioning Tutors | Machine Learning/ AI Tutors

Find Local Tutors in Marin County

We have tutors available who are experts in over 300 subjects. Compare rates and reviews to find your ideal 1:1 tutor:

Marin County Computer Programming Lessons | Marin County Computer Tutors | Marin County Adobe InDesign Tutors

Find Tutors in a County Near You for Coding

Tap into our extensive network of private tutors in nearby counties:

Jefferson County Tutors | Utah County Tutors | Contra Costa County Tutors | King County Tutors

Find Marin County tutors

Want to browse local tutors near you in more subjects? See all tutors in Marin County

Find online coding tutors

Get coding help anytime! We only accept the best online coding tutors into our community. Get the help you need, right when you need it with the convenience of online lessons.